In the event that a wheel speed sensor fails, the ABS, traction control system (TCS) and manufacturer specific stability control system lights will illuminate, informing the driver that the systems are disabled. The vehicle will be more prone to tire slip, and normal driving patterns may need to be adjusted to correct for the loss of computer control. On older vehicle's, the speedometer can be affected, causing illumination of the check engine light as well.
When troubleshooting cruise control issues in your BMW 440i, it's crucial to adopt a systematic diagnostic approach. Begin by checking the simplest potential problems, such as a blown fuse. Locate the cruise control fuse in the vehicle's fuse box and inspect it for any signs of damage; replacing a blown fuse can often resolve the issue quickly. Next, assess the condition of your vehicle's battery, as weak batteries can lead to cruise control malfunctions. If these initial checks do not yield results, turn your attention to the speed sensor, which may require cleaning or replacement if it is dirty. Additionally, inspect the wiring for any faults, as damaged wiring can disrupt the cruise control system's functionality. Don't overlook the throttle control mechanism; ensuring it is clean and undamaged is essential for proper operation. Lastly, if you notice that the cruise control engages and disengages unexpectedly, examine the actuator's gear wheel for broken teeth, particularly at the 9 o'clock position. By following this methodical approach, you can effectively diagnose and resolve cruise control issues, ensuring a smoother driving experience.
When dealing with a cruise control malfunction in a BMW 440i, it's essential to understand the common problems that may arise. One frequent culprit is the speed sensors, which can become dirty or fail, disrupting the communication with the vehicle's computer and leading to erratic cruise control behavior. Additionally, intermittent failures can occur, particularly at lower speeds, where the system may behave unpredictably, such as the cruise control buttons lighting up inconsistently. Another significant issue could be a faulty cruise control actuator, which may suffer from bad solder joints, especially in high-temperature conditions, causing the system to fail altogether. While some of these problems can be addressed through DIY methods, others may require professional diagnosis and repair, particularly if the malfunction poses a safety risk while driving. Understanding these common issues can help you troubleshoot effectively and determine whether a simple fix is possible or if you need to seek expert assistance.
When your BMW 440i's cruise control system fails, it’s crucial to understand the potential causes and the urgency of addressing them. A malfunctioning cruise control can stem from several issues, including failed or dirty speed sensors, which are vital for the system's communication with the vehicle's computer. Neglecting to clean or replace these sensors can lead to further complications. Additionally, a blown fuse or a defective brake pedal switch can disrupt the cruise control's functionality, posing safety risks if the system unexpectedly disengages while driving. It's also important to consider the throttle control system and ABS, as problems in these areas can directly affect cruise control performance. If the brake pedal switch is faulty, it may inadvertently signal the system to deactivate, leading to frustrating and potentially dangerous driving experiences. Therefore, promptly checking and replacing any blown fuses, as well as inspecting the brake pedal and sensors, is essential to ensure your cruise control operates safely and effectively. Addressing these issues not only enhances your driving experience but also prevents further damage to your vehicle.
